Family recollection associated this portrait with Margarete ‘Mutti’ Reichenbach. The card’s W. Höffert imprint, studio-address configuration, dress and hairstyle place it in the late nineteenth century; Margarete, born in 1889, would have been a child. Comparison with the later portrait of Jenny Schottländer Liebenthal and Philipp Liebenthal makes Jenny a plausible candidate, but facial resemblance is not identification, and no inscription or independent record names the sitter.
